Memory games
Memory games for kids are an excellent way to develop your child's memory. These games are easy to play and can be very enjoyable. This game's basic idea is that one player starts by saying any number between one and nine. The next player must then repeat the same pattern, while adding one of their own. These games can help children not only learn numbers, but they will also improve their concentration.

Matching games
Matching games for kids are an excellent way to help develop visual skills. They force kids to concentrate on visual details and sharpen their memory. You can also personalize these games with images of your family, words or other content to make them more interesting and memorable.

Creativity games
Use creative matching games to keep your toddler entertained and engaged. These games can be made out of craft materials or used objects. Make sure the game has a theme. Try matching letters, shapes and objects for preschoolers. Younger children can use matching household tools or foods.

How much money does a teacher make in early childhood education? (earning potential)
A teacher in early childhood earns an average salary of $45,000 per annum.
However, there are areas where salaries tend to be higher than average. For example, teachers in large urban school districts typically receive more pay than those in rural schools.
Salaries are also affected by factors like the size of the district and whether or not a teacher holds a master's degree or doctorate.
Because they lack experience, teachers often make less than other college graduates. Over time, however, their wages can increase dramatically.
